At what age should I expect my child to start talking?
Most children start saying their first words around 12 months, but it can vary from 10 to 14 months.
What are some signs that my child is ready to talk?
Look for signs like babbling, imitating sounds, and responding to their name. These indicate readiness.
Is there anything I can do to encourage my child to talk?
Yes! Reading to them, talking frequently, and encouraging them to express themselves can help.
What if my child isn't talking by 18 months?
If your child isn't talking by 18 months, it might be a good idea to consult a pediatrician for advice.
